Quoted: Bacon wrapped were more addictive than I thought. I will have to get smaller peppers next time though. What I do a lot is cut the top off, slice in half (length wise), and de-seed. Fill inside with cream cheese, wrap in bacon, and place on skewer. Then grill for 30-45 minutes. They are outstanding. They are also really good with a piece of shrimp stuffed inside of them. |
